抄録
The field-cooled magnetization (FCM) processes of Ising spin glasses under relatively small fields are investigated by experiment on Fe0.55Mn0.45TiO3 and by numerical simulation on the three-dimensional Edwards–Anderson model. Both results are explained in a unified manner by means of the droplet picture. In particular, the cusp-like behavior of the FCM is interpreted as evidence, not for an equilibrium phase transition under a finite magnetic field, but for a dynamical (‘blocking’) transition frequently observed in glassy systems.
